Edistir® N 3910

Generic Family: Polystyrene, General PurposeSupplied by: Versalis S.p.A.
Edistir® N 3910 is a very easy flow general purpose polystyrene. Used for injection of thin-walled, multi-cavity, very fast-cycle mouldings and sheet extrusion for glossy capping of HIPS sheets and in blends with HIPS or clear SBS. Thanks to Edistir® N 3910, injected items will be bright and neutral coloured in line with the most sophisticated market needs.

Designation: Thermoplastics ISO 1622-PS,G,085-20.

Applications
Edistir® N 3910 is suitable in a large variety of sectors such as:
  • food packaging containers
  • cosmetics
  • toys
  • medical articles
  • carrier for masterbatches.
